Global Overview
The global Automotive Immersion Cooling Dielectric Fluid market is valued at USD 1,472 million in 2025 and is projected to reach USD 4,520 million by 2032, reflecting a CAGR of 17.4%. Total consumption volume in 2025 is estimated at 28,307 tons, with an average selling price (ASP) of approximately USD 52,000 per ton.
Demand growth is not purely volume-driven but tied to the increasing penetration of immersion-ready EV platforms and high-performance battery systems.
Core demand drivers include the rapid scaling of high-voltage fast-charging EV platforms exceeding 800V architectures, increasing thermal density in battery packs requiring direct-contact cooling, OEM push for extended battery lifecycle and warranty optimization, and integration of onboard AI computing systems generating additional thermal loads.

Production and Supply Chain
Value capture in the immersion cooling fluid market is concentrated at the formulation and certification stages rather than bulk production. While base chemicals remain commoditized, the blending, additive engineering, and validation processes create differentiation. Gross margins average around 27%, with premium formulations exceeding 30% in niche applications such as aviation and high-performance EVs.
A standard production line has a capacity of approximately 500 tons per year, indicating that scaling the industry requires significant capital investment in both infrastructure and technical validation capabilities. Unlike conventional fluids, dielectric fluids must meet stringent electrical insulation, thermal conductivity, and material compatibility requirements, limiting the number of qualified suppliers.
Asia plays a strategic role in both upstream and downstream segments. China dominates base chemical production and early-stage formulation, while Japan and South Korea lead in high-purity and specialty fluids. Southeast Asia is increasingly important for blending, packaging, and regional distribution, with Singapore and Malaysia serving as logistics and chemical processing hubs. Indonesia and Thailand are emerging as consumption-driven production bases tied to EV assembly operations.
Latest Technological Developments
The market is seeing the integration of AI-driven thermal telemetry systems that dynamically adjust cooling performance based on battery load conditions, improving efficiency and extending battery life.
There is increasing development of ultra-low viscosity dielectric fluids below 10 cSt to enable faster heat dissipation while maintaining electrical insulation properties.
Two-phase immersion cooling technologies are gaining traction, where fluids undergo phase change to absorb higher thermal loads, particularly in high-performance EV and aviation applications.
Material compatibility advancements are enabling direct immersion of entire battery modules without degradation of seals, plastics, or metals, reducing system complexity.
Fluorinated fluid innovations are improving fire resistance and thermal stability, addressing safety concerns in high energy density battery systems.
Closed-loop recycling systems are being developed to recover and reuse dielectric fluids, improving sustainability metrics and reducing lifecycle costs.

Product Pricing Variations
Pricing varies significantly based on viscosity, chemistry type, performance grade, and supplier positioning.
In ultra-low viscosity fluids, products such as Shells immersion cooling fluids and ExxonMobils synthetic dielectric oils are priced between USD 48,000 and USD 65,000 per ton, depending on purity and thermal performance. These are typically used in high-performance EV platforms requiring rapid heat dissipation.
For fluorocarbon-based fluids, such as those produced by 3M under its engineered fluids portfolio, pricing ranges from USD 70,000 to USD 120,000 per ton due to superior dielectric properties and fire resistance. These are commonly used in safety-critical and aviation applications.
Hydrocarbon-based dielectric fluids from companies like TotalEnergies are priced between USD 35,000 and USD 50,000 per ton, offering a cost-effective solution for mid-range EV applications, though with slightly lower thermal performance.
Silicone-based fluids, such as those manufactured by Dow, typically range from USD 55,000 to USD 80,000 per ton, driven by their high thermal stability and long lifecycle performance in demanding environments.
Performance-grade variations also influence pricing. Standard industrial-grade fluids are priced near the market ASP of USD 52,000 per ton, while high-purity EV-grade fluids with extended lifecycle and enhanced dielectric strength command premiums of 15 to 30%.
